Seasonality in Literature

Seasonality in literature refers to the depiction of different seasons as symbols or backdrops within various literary forms. Autumn is a season often associated with change, reflection, and transition. Writers use the autumn season to convey themes of decay, nostalgia, and transformation. The imagery of falling leaves, harvest, and cooler weather can evoke emotions tied to impermanence and letting go. Exploring the idea of seasonality allows readers to understand how poets utilize natural changes to mirror human experiences and emotions.

Symbolism in Poetry

Symbolism in poetry involves using objects, images, or seasons to represent larger ideas or concepts. Autumn serves as a potent symbol for various themes, including the passage of time and the inevitability of change. Poets may employ autumnal imagery to explore complex feelings such as melancholy, beauty in decay, and the bittersweet nature of memories. By examining how poets use symbols, one can gain insight into the deeper meanings woven within poems about autumn.

Thematic Development in Poetry

Thematic development in poetry is the progression of ideas that explore a central theme throughout a poem. In poems centered on autumn, poets may develop themes related to mortality, the cycle of life, or the richness of nature’s transformations. The seasonal changes observed in autumn become focal points that drive narratives and emotional journeys within the poetic structure. Understanding thematic development helps readers appreciate how autumn can serve as a canvas for exploring profound human truths and experiences.
